  3. Manual action needed to resolve boot failure for Fedora Atomic Desktops and Fedora IoT.

    Since the 39.20240617.0 and 40.20240617.0 updates for Atomic Desktops and the 40.20240617.0 update for IoT, systems with Secure Boot enabled may fail to boot if they have been installed before Fedora Linux 40.

    Details in fedoramagazine.org/manual-acti

  4. Due to a bug in rpm-ostree, the '/etc/[g]shadow[-]' files in Fedora CoreOS, Fedora IoT and Fedora Atomic Desktops have the world-readable bit set.

    To fix impacted systems immediately, run the following command as root:
    $ chmod --verbose 0000 /etc/shadow /etc/gshadow /etc/shadow- /etc/gshadow-

    For more details, notably the full list of affected versions, see: github.com/coreos/rpm-ostree/s
